Presentation Makes or Breaks Your Unique Pharma Brand By Rajan Kumar  In today’s competitive pharmaceutical industry, brand building is no longer just about having a unique product. A unique pharma brand can fail if its presentation is weak. The truth is simple: presentation makes or breaks your unique pharma brand. If your brand identity is not communicated properly, it will fade away in the crowded marketplace.  Why Presentation Matters in Pharma Branding Pharma companies often focus on molecules, formulations, and clinical data. But patients, doctors, and distributors connect with presentation—the way your brand looks, feels, and communicates. Packaging, logo design, product detailing, and even the tone of your communication decide whether your brand survives or dies.  A unique brand without proper presentation is like a powerful medicine kept in a plain, unlabelled bottle.
